Abstract:
The heat conductivity and electrical resistivity of a polycrystalline YbAgCu4 sample were measured in the 4.2–300-K temperature range. It is shown that at low temperatures (in the region corresponding to the coherent Kondo lattice) the Lorenz number behaves in accordance with a theoretical model developed for heavy-fermion materials.
